The average bus between Taree and Nerang takes 10h 47m and the fastest bus takes 10h 39m. The bus service runs several times per day from Taree to Nerang.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Buses run 3 times a day between Taree and Nerang. The earliest departure is at 12:30 AM at night, and the last departure from Taree is at 11:55 PM which arrives into Nerang at 10:34 AM. All services require a transfer at Southport and take an average of 10h 47m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ct bus from Taree to Nerang. However, there are services departing from Taree station and arriving at Nerang station via Southport.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 10h 47m.
Taree to Nerang bus services, operated by Greyhound Australia, depart from Taree station.
Taree to Nerang bus services, operated by Greyhound Australia, arrive at Southport station.
The distance between Taree and Nerang is 444.3 km. The road distance is 610 km.
Greyhound Australia operates a bus from Taree to Southport twice daily. Tickets cost $95–210 and the journey takes 10h 5m. Premier Motor Service also services this route once daily.
